Purple Rain
Dir. Albert Magnoli 1984 111 mins US
“Dearly Beloved, we are gathered here today to get through this thing called Life…” This screening is in honour to Prince on what would have been his 58th birthday on June 7th.
Based on aspects of Prince’s real childhood and life, we follow the “Kid” as the talented but troubled frontman of his band the Revolution. Is he going to echo the emotional and physical violence of his parents and become an abusive loser? Or will he become a sensual, sexy, tender, genderfluid, expressive, rocktastic musical mega star?
Fundraiser for the Unity Group
This film is subtitled for deaf/hard of hearing audiences and the introduction BSL interpreted
